IT is looking unlikely that any of the historic Borders festivals will take place this summer.
Committees across the region have reacted to the coronavirus outbreak by cancelling their festivals and common ridings.
Jethart Callant's Festival organisers led the way on Wednesday evening by announcing its cancellation.
A decision to call off Hawick Common Riding, the Braw Lads' Gathering and Beltane Festival in Peebles quickly followed.
Officials at St Ronan's Borders Games Week and Coldstream Civic Week also announced cancellations.
Earlier today Kelso Civic Week was also called off for 2020.
Appointment night will go ahead as planned in West Linton this evening, but the Whipman and Whipman's Lass will be unveiled behind closed doors on a Facebook Live stream.
